Other Item Powers
There are a variety of other powers that you can embed in an item. Many are very useful; some are not so useful. The following describes these powers with EP cost for each power and a few comments from my own experience.

Repairs Items |
while item is equipped |
900 |
Magic item repair will not work unless "magicrepair 1" has been added to your z.cfg file and you're running the latest patch. Items are repaired based on their location in your inventory (top first). Multiple items with this effect will accelerate repairs and can work on more than one item at a time. |

Enhances Skill |
pick a skill |
while item is equipped |
900 per skill |
Adds about 15 points to the affected skill. Skills enhanced by items with this power can exceed 100 and the enhanced skill will be used for determining your rank within the guild. Multiple enhancements in a single item are not effective, but enhancements from multiple items are. |
Feather Weight |
always (even when unequipped) |
100 |
Reduces weight of the item to .25 kg. Effect is always operational, but item weighs normal amount if you try to put it on your wagon. Think about it: a full suit of daedric armor weighs 1.75 kg if each piece is enchanted with feather weight. I've never had a piece of armor wear out when this was the only enchantment on it. This effect will also negate the additional weight side effect that comes from some soul bindings, but it must be added BEFORE adding the soul bound side efect. |
